The UAE’s Commando Group emerged victorious at the inaugural Abu Dhabi World Grappling Championship, held at the ADNEC Centre in Al Ain. The team’s top performance highlighted the nation’s rising prominence in grappling sports and its commitment to nurturing world-class athletes. The championship attracted more than 1,000 athletes from over 60 countries, creating a competitive and diverse international event.
Officials praised the UAE Commando Group for their discipline, skill, and strategy, which contributed to their top honours. The team excelled across multiple categories, demonstrating technical precision, strength, and endurance. Their success reflects rigorous training programs and the growing focus on grappling sports within the UAE’s military and professional sporting sectors.
The Abu Dhabi Grappling Championship is designed to showcase talent from around the world, promote international sports collaboration, and provide a platform for athletes to compete at the highest level. The event included a wide range of competitions, such as gi and no-gi divisions, weight-class matches, and team events, attracting both seasoned professionals and rising stars.
Athletes from Europe, Asia, the Americas, and the Middle East competed, creating a diverse and highly competitive environment.
